Galaxy Note PhonesI have three "friends" in my Together with S Health - but two of them are accounts from a company that I bought something from years ago and have no idea who the people are. Is there a way to remove these from my friends list? I don't see any "edit" or "delete" features in the friends section at all.
I have this app on my Note 5 phone and synced with my S3 Frontier watch

But, the simple answer is, anyone in your phone "contacts" will be synced into your S Health "friends" - so the solution is to remove them from your contacts and then refresh your S Health friend list

Galaxy Note PhonesWhere it shows the list of your friends, go to block list, then add, add the person you dlnt want to share information with and thats it. I tried deleting the person from.my contact list but it didnt work- stalker ex- so I did this and it works.
